Output 85f413992fc9cc23bc21c37297d2fa17646301fe276b010cf269f2a4bbc3efb4:1

value
2780603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f746da6c48784f6f5d857fc1c4b263a06ecc518d OP_EQUAL
address
3QEVhtn74WDChu54hjJ9QXe6xHhFVC3UyC
transaction
85f413992fc9cc23bc21c37297d2fa17646301fe276b010cf269f2a4bbc3efb4
confirmations
170240
spent
true